It’s the #Insulin Stupid – Again ! #Diabetes #HDL

Oh here we go again; I’ll never tire of reminding people that Insulin sits at the center of Heart Disease risk, and most other modern afflictions also.

Here are a couple of great papers – the first deals with C-Peptide levels and the Mortality Reality (for ‘C-Peptide’ read ‘Insulin’). The second also deals with C-Peptide, and crosses it with our old friend HDLc; one reason why higher HDLc is good for you, is it tracks with LOW C-Peptide). Of course if you have lower HDLc, but also LOW C-Peptide, that can be cool too – work it out peeps:
